The heating coil in a toaster is made of nichrome wire with a radius of 0.275 mm. If the coil draws a current of 8.40 A when there is a 120 V potential difference across its ends, find the following. (Take the resistivity of nichrome to be 1.50 ✕ 10−6 Ω · m.) (a) resistance of the coil (in Ω) Ω (b) length of wire used to wind the coil (in m) m
